## Step 4 — Deploy the reconnect fix

The Mirelock gateway dropped websocket sessions on transient DNS hiccups and never re-dialed; the fix adds exponential backoff with jitter and a session-resume token. Reviewer checklist: confirm backoff caps at 30s, resume token expires server-side, and no reconnect storm in the load test logs. Build the gateway image, run the soak suite, then push to staging. The staging registry rejects unsigned images, so sign the push with the key below.

release key, hahop-fajef: bky6_G6gfvh

## Runbook: Tracing a request across Ploverline services

Welcome aboard. When debugging latency at Ploverline, start by grabbing the trace ID from the gateway logs, then query the Spanwell trace-collector to see every hop the request made. Spanwell stitches spans from checkout, inventory, and notifications into one timeline. You'll need authenticated access to its internal query endpoint; never reuse a teammate's credential, and log your lookup in the audit channel. The shared read-only key for the trace-collector service is below.

API key for tagef-fafop: vxb2-ta

Handover — Eastern Expansion

Hi all — quick handover as I pass the Marloweck expansion to Dara. Site shortlist is down to two: Kettlebrook and the old Finstowe depot. Local hiring partner is signed, lease talks ongoing. Dara has the full deck and knows the landlords. Nothing scary in the numbers so far. The confidential note on our rollout plans sits just below this.

confidential, fajop-fajef: Soriusax Foods plans to lower the Rusix list price by 43.2 percent in December. The steering committee signed off on a budget of $74.0 million for Project Oliion. The renewal with Brivanix Works closes at $118.6 million a year, 43.4 percent above the last contract. Project Ulaiel slips by six weeks because of the audit delay.

# NightGlean backfill scheduler.
# Security notes: jobs run under a scoped service role; no job may
# escalate past read-replica access. Retry windows are bounded so a
# poisoned payload cannot loop indefinitely. Concurrency is capped
# per tenant to prevent cross-tenant starvation. All limits are
# enforced server-side; client hints are advisory only.
# The enforced constants are defined immediately below.

constants for tageg-kagag:
QUOTAS = {
    "kelax": 495,
    "istath": 366,
    "tammir": 108,
    "novdor": 730,
    "casax": 816,
    "quenael": 874,
    "pelius": 403,
}